Artist Talk with Anna Lee

January 17 @ 4:00 pm - 5:30 pm
Join multimedia artist Anna Lee and curator Annah Lee for a discussion of Anna’s solo exhibition on view at Artspace Dec 5-Feb 2.

Join artist Anna Lee and former Artspace Creative Director Annah Lee for a conversation on animation, the dissonance of living in the age of technology, memory, and more as they discuss Anna’s solo exhibition My notifs are off, come to my art show on view at Artspace from Dec 5-Feb 2.

About Anna Lee

Anna Lee is a multimedia artist and filmmaker with a BA in Art and Design from NC State. She was a 2024 NC Emerging Artist in Residence at Artspace and is the founder and curator of Scatterbrain Screenings, a screening and workshop series focused on showcasing the work of independent animators in the Triangle. She is currently pursuing an MFA in Experimental and Documentary Arts at Duke University. In addition to her visual pursuits, she is a performing flautist and composes original music for the majority of her film projects. About Artspace

Artspace is a non-profit visual arts center located in Downtown Raleigh. Visit Artspace to explore exhibitions featuring national and community artists, engage with more than 35 artists working in their studios, and enjoy art classes and community events for all ages and abilities.
